    Scoring a round is not just a sum up of who connected more punches but a subjective judging of who dominated the round , who connected shots which had an effect , who boxed more clean and who had the better defense .

    Here usyk was the better skilled , technically superior boxer on many rounds and imho deserved the win .

    I mean, I get it. I get why some people gave Fury a couple rounds more than I did, like if I change round 1 and round 10 (rounds I thought were close) my 118-110 score becomes 116-112. That's only a change of two rounds, 115-113 is only changing 3 rounds. I don't think a lot of people really think about the break down of rounds in that manner where if you really change just a couple things, the score can swing dramatically.
